Galatians 3:5

Does God lavish His Spirit on you and work miracles among you because you practice the law, or because you hear and believe?

Berean Standard Bible
Other translations

King James Version

He therefore that ministereth to you the Spirit, and worketh miracles among you, doeth he it by the works of the law, or by the hearing of faith?

World English Bible

He therefore who supplies the Spirit to you and does miracles among you, does he do it by the works of the law, or by hearing of faith?

American Standard Version

He therefore that supplieth to you the Spirit, and worketh miracles among you, doeth he it by the works of the law, or by the hearing of faith?

Geneva Bible 1599

He therefore that ministreth to you the Spirit, and worketh miracles among you, doeth he it through the workes of the Law, or by the hearing of faith preached?

Darby Translation

He therefore who ministers to you the Spirit, and works miracles among you, [is it] on the principle of works of law, or of [the] report of faith?

Young's Literal Translation

He, therefore, who is supplying to you the Spirit, and working mighty acts among you — by works of law or by the hearing of faith [is it]?

Bible in Basic English

He who gives you the Spirit, and does works of power among you, is it by the works of law, or by the hearing of faith?
